The West Coast
This is the area of tranquil beaches, sand dunes, bridges, and lush pastures where the sea is touched by an unadulterated wilderness. Pori is famous for its annual internationally renowned Jazz Festival, which sets the town in upbeat mood for a whole week in July. It also has a fabulous beach called Yyteri. The Vaasa region has an astonishing mixture of Finnish and Swedish culture particularly observed in small villages and old wooden towns.

Pori town
Kvarken is a UNESCO World Natural Heritage where land is uplifted as it rises up from the sea with an 8mm average every year. One can take a relaxing cruise from Kokkola in central Ostrobothnia to the lighthouse island of Tankar and the Seven Bridges archipelago. Oulu, the largest city in the norther Nordic region, is home to great shopping and an open-air museum. It is most popularly known to be Finland’s “silicon valley.”
